Garage Gutter Cleaning in Pittsburgh, PA
Garage gutter cleaning services involve removing deb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t from the gutters and downspouts of a property’s garage. This service helps ensure that rainwater flows properly away from the structure, preventing potential water damage, foundation issues, and basement flooding. Projects typically include clearing out clogged gutters, inspecting for damage or leaks, and flushing the system to maintain optimal drainage. Homeowners often request this service when gutters become visibly blocked or after severe weather events, aiming to protect their property from water-related problems.
Before requesting garage gutter cleaning, property owners should consider the current condition of their gutters and whether there are signs of overflowing or standing water. It’s also helpful to determine the height and accessibility of the gutters to ensure proper service planning. Understanding the scope of the project, including the number of gutters and any specific concerns such as damage or leaks, can facilitate a smoother process. Regular gutter maintenance can help extend the lifespan of the system and prevent costly repairs down the line.

Garage Gutter Cleaning Questions
Why is gutter cleaning important for garages? Regular gutter cleaning prevents water buildup that can cause damage to garage walls, floors, and foundations, helping to maintain the structure's integrity.
What types of debris are typically removed during garage gutter cleaning? Leaves, twigs, dirt, and other blockages that can obstruct water flow are commonly cleared from garage gutters.
How often should garage gutters be cleaned? It is recommended to clean garage gutters at least twice a year to prevent clogging and water damage.
What signs indicate that garage gutters need cleaning? Overflowing water, sagging gutters, or visible debris are signs that gutters require attention and cleaning.
